Bid Multipliers Target Metadata¶
This article describes resources that enable you to read metadata used in Native Lines Bid Multiplier Targets.
Note
Optimizing for performance: Since the metadata does not change often, we highly recommend clients to cache the response (with a cache expiry between 1 and 6 hours).
Endpoint¶
/traffic/targeting/bidmultipliertargets

Sample Request URL¶
GET https://dspapi.admanagerplus.yahoo.com/traffic/targeting/bidmultipliertargets
Sample Response (Partial)¶
{
"response": [
{
"id": 1,
"type": "SUPPLY_GROUP",
"name": "GROUP 1A (1.0 - 9.0)",
"description": "Access\n higher-performing inventory on large format devices across various Yahoo sites and third party\n publishers.",
"minMultiplier": 1,
"maxMultiplier": 9
},
{
"id": 280,
"type": "SITE_X_DEVICE",
"name": "News US - Mobile",
"minMultiplier": 0.2,
"maxMultiplier": 9
},
{
"id": 506,
"type": "SITE_GROUP_X_DEVICE",
"name": "ABC News - Mobile",
"minMultiplier": 0.2,
"maxMultiplier": 9
}
],
"errors": null,
"timeStamp": "2022-01-06T22:52:07.349Z"
}
